A colony of coral polyps lives in a skeleton-like framework of its own making. It's equal part anchor and house. This framework is what many people think of as coral. By itself, the skeleton is ghostly white. It's the animals living in the skeleton that give it its color. Coral polyps catch food drifting in the water.

The contrasting color to coral on the color wheel is a deep shade of blue, so if you want to make coral pop, then this is the best shade to use. Coral can also contrast really beautifully against muted green shades such as olive and sage. For a simple style with a vibrant pop of color, paint your walls white and use coral accents such as coral.

The hex code for coral is #FF7F50. It represents a vibrant orange-red color with 100% red, 49.8% green and 31.4% blue. It has a hue angle of 16.1 degrees, a saturation of 100%, and a lightness of 65.7%. In the C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 50.2% magenta, 68.6% yellow and 0% black. Coral is a pink-orange hue named for its representations of the colors of cnidarians, known as precious corals. The coral hex code is #FF7F50. Breaking it down in an RGB color space, hex #FF7F50 is made of 100% red, 49.8% green and 31.4% blue.
